Body: has reportedly targeted oil infrastructure deep within , aiming to disrupt supply chains linked to energy production. Such actions reflect a strategic effort to influence economic resources tied to the ongoing conflict.

Energy facilities have long been considered critical assets in modern warfare, not only for their role in sustaining military operations but also for their broader economic significance. Disruptions can affect production, transportation, and revenue streams.

However, analysts note that rising global fuel prices may complicate the intended impact of these strikes. Higher prices can offset losses by increasing the value of remaining production, potentially softening the economic effect.

The global nature of energy markets means that local disruptions can resonate internationally. Changes in supply and pricing often ripple outward, influencing economies far beyond the immediate region.

For Ukraine, targeting infrastructure represents one of several approaches aimed at exerting pressure. These actions are part of a wider set of strategies that combine military, economic, and diplomatic elements.

Observers emphasize that the relationship between physical disruption and economic outcome is not always linear. Market responses, policy decisions, and external factors all play a role in shaping the final impact.

The situation also highlights the interconnectedness of energy systems, where production, pricing, and geopolitics intersect in complex ways.
